SOURCES: 1. Cokayne, G.E., _The Complete Peerage_, Vol. XII, pt. 1, p. 343-4: Fulk leStrange was aged 18 on 2 Feb 1348/49. He married (contractdated 12 Mar 1346/47) Elizabeth, daughter of Ralph de Stafford, 1st Earl of Stafford, by his second wife, Margaret, daughter and heir ofHugh de Audley, Earl of Gloucester. He died without male issue 30 Aug1349. Elizabeth married secondly to Sir John de Ferrers and third,Reynold de Cobham, 2nd Lord Cobham. She died 7 Aug 1375. Fulk and Elizabethhad two daughters who were infants at their father's death, Joan, whomarried John Careless or Carless, and Eleanor, who married Edward de Acton. However, a Hampton jury found that Fulk had died without heir ofhis body and declared his younger brother John to be his heir.

* '''"Royal Ancestry" Douglas Richard, 2013, Vol. I. p. 374''': Fulk Le Strange, 3rd Lord Strange of Blackmere, of Whitchurch, Shropshire, son and heir, born 2 Feb. 1330/1. He married 1342-3 Elizabeth De Stafford, daughter of Ralph de Stafford, K.G., 1st Earl of Stafford,by his 2nd wife, Margaret, daughter of Hugh de Audley, Knt., Earl of Gloucester. They had no issue. He was never summoned to Parliament. Fulk Le Strange, 3rd Lord Strange of Blackmere, died during the pestilence 6 Sept. (or 22 or 30 August) 1340.
Elizabeth died 7 august 1376.

Note: page 172 " The wife of Robert le Strange was Alianora, or Eleanor, second daughter and co-heiress of William de Whitchurch [de Albo Monasterio], from whom he ultimately acquired and transmitted to his descendants a considerable inheritance ; William, who died before June n, 1260, left four daughters ; the eldest, Berta, was an imbecile, and died in 1281"
page 206 "This Eleanor (the daughter and co-heir of William de Blancminster, or Whit- church) was relict of Robert le Strange, Lord in her right of Blackmere, who died in 1276.
